Window Frame Replacement in Wilmington, NC
Window frame replacement services involve removing existing window frames and installing new ones to improve the appearance, functionality, and energy efficiency of a home. This process covers a variety of projects, including upgrading outdated or damaged frames, enhancing curb appeal, or addressing issues like warping, rotting, or drafts. Homeowners often seek this service when they notice problems such as difficulty opening or closing windows, increased energy bills, or visible deterioration around window edges. Understanding the different materials available, such as wood, vinyl, or aluminum, and how they complement the home's style can help property owners make informed decisions before requesting replacement work.
Before requesting window frame replacement, property owners typically want to know about the scope of the project, including whether the existing window openings need adjustments or repairs. It’s also important to consider the compatibility of new frames with existing window styles and the potential impact on insulation and security. Clarifying any concerns about the timeline, potential disruptions, and the overall benefits of upgrading can help ensure the project aligns with the property's needs and expectations. Proper planning and understanding of these factors can lead to a successful window frame replacement that enhances the home's comfort and appearance.

Window Frame Replacement Questions
What are the signs that window frames need replacement? Signs include rotting, warping, cracked paint, or difficulty opening and closing the windows.
How does replacing window frames improve a property? It enhances energy efficiency, boosts curb appeal, and helps prevent further damage to the window structure.
What types of materials are available for window frame replacement? Common options include vinyl, wood, aluminum, and composite materials, each offering different benefits.
Is window frame replacement suitable for historic or older homes? Yes, it can restore the appearance and functionality while maintaining the property's character.
